Phil,

If enlarging the canvas to provide space for a border was a larger effort than you had in mind, a simple way to do it (if you didn’t mind covering up just a bit of the image around the edges) would be…

Create a selection line around the perimeter, have the color you wish for the border showing as the foreground color in the swatch at bottom of Tool Box and go Edit>Stroke and choose the width in pixels (choosing "Inside" for placement).
